Invalidation load on the Marrowgate catalog cache scales with write volume, not read volume, so the spring merchandising push is the binding constraint. Each SKU update fans out to roughly forty regional edge entries; the sweeper must clear them within one refresh cycle or we serve stale prices. Reviewer note: the fan-out multiplier is derived, not configured — please verify the derivation in sweeper.go. The planning constants assumed here are listed below.

tuning constants:
QUOTAS = {
    "druwyn": 5,
    "holix": 5,
    "zorath": 5,
    "holwyn": 10,
}

Welcome aboard! Quick note on the tax-rate lookup cache: it warms itself from the Brindlewick Rates service every hour, so don't panic if entries look stale right after a deploy. If the cache misses spike, just bounce the warmer job. To query the warmer's admin endpoint directly, use the key below.

service key, fawip-bajef: kto11_Qt5wZK9vdNC

Action item (P1): add replay protection to the Tindholm parcel-tracking webhook. During the incident, the carrier resent three days of delivery events after their outage, and our handler processed each duplicate, corrupting shipment timelines. New team members should know the handler is currently idempotent only per event ID, not per shipment state. The fix introduces a sequence-number check before any status write. The design doc and review checklist are on the internal page below.

operations page: https://jenkins.zemvarcloud.local/job/merge_requests/repo/build/73930b4b30f0a8ed

To: Executive Team
Subject: Marketing budget reduction — Q3

All,

Effective next quarter, marketing spend drops 22%. Sponsorships and the Larkspan campaign are cut; digital retention spend stays. Brynja, as incoming director, you inherit the revised envelope — detailed lines arrive Monday. No external comms until announced. Questions to me directly. Context for the cut is in the confidential note below.

management briefing: Gross margin on Holath came in at 20 percent against a plan of 10 percent. Only 9 of the 100 pilot accounts renewed Holath, so a churn review is set for January 15.